The size of South Nowra is approximately 8.9 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 29.6% of total area. The population of South Nowra in 2011 was 1,019 people. By 2016 the population was 1,911 showing a population growth of 87.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in South Nowra is 0-9 years. Households in South Nowra are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in South Nowra work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 65.4% of the homes in South Nowra were owner-occupied compared with 68.5% in 2016.
